Congratulations to our new V1P, Lettitia Furrow! Lettitia and her sisiter Marcie K Altice, were both diagnosed with T1D at an early age and their parents were very active in JDRF when they were younger. They have both continued to be involved and have walked in the JDRF One Walk for as long as they can remember.
Lettitia has had diabetes for 32 years and has used an insulin pump for 25 years. She is grateful for all of the research that has been done to improve the treatment(s) of T1D. She is also very grateful for the support from my family, friends, and community! Lettitia is married to Steve and has two boys, Ethan (10) and Benjamin (8). She is a physical therapist for Carilion Franklin Memorial Hospital Outpatient Rehabilitation. She is also a member and plays the piano for Doe Run Christian Church.
